Ubuntu Howtos

From Cactus Howto
Revision as of 08:37, 13 October 2016 by Tim (talk | contribs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igationJump to search

Ubuntu Systemeinstellungen diverses

Vollen Hauptspeicher (>3GB) bei 32bit OS nutzen

sudo aptitude install linux-generic-pae linux-headers-generic-pae
sudo init 6

gpg-Keys unter Ubuntu in apt importieren

Skript anlegen mit folgendem Inhalt:

gpg --keyserver hkp://subkeys.pgp.net --recv-keys $1
gpg --export --armor $1 | sudo apt-key add -

Ubuntu auf ISO lokalisieren

Ubuntu ist ab Version 6.06 völlig auf UTF-8 zugeschnitten und hat die ISO-8859 per default auch nicht mehr installiert. Hier hilft auch kein dpkg-reconfigure locales. Dennoch läßt dich die neue Ubuntu-Version auf de_DE.iso885915@euro lokalisieren (Quelle: http://www.matrica.de/download/menzel.txt):

tim@uxpieks:~$ sudo su -
root@uxpieks:~# echo de_DE@euro ISO-8859-15 >> /var/lib/locales/supported.d/de
root@uxpieks:~# cat /var/lib/locales/supported.d/de
de_DE.UTF-8 UTF-8
de_CH.UTF-8 UTF-8
de_BE.UTF-8 UTF-8
de_LU.UTF-8 UTF-8
de_AT.UTF-8 UTF-8
de_DE@euro ISO-8859-15
root@uxpieks:~# dpkg-reconfigure locales
Generating locales...
  de_CH.UTF-8... done
  de_DE.ISO-8859-15@euro... done
  de_DE.ISO-8859-1... up-to-date
[snip]
Generation complete.


Postgres unter Ubuntu mit korrekter Umlaut-Darstellung

 LC_MESSAGES = 'en_US.UTF-8'
 LC_MONETARY = 'en_US.UTF-8'
 LC_NUMERIC = 'en_US.UTF-8'
 LC_TIME = 'en_US.UTF-8'

an postgresql.conf anhängen

Displayauflösung anpassen (Intel chipset 845G/855G/865G/915G/945G)

http://roland-lopez.blogspot.com/2007/03/auto915resolution-ubuntu-resolution-fix.html

Falls unter System -> Einstellungen -> Bildschirmauflösung der gewünschte Modus noch nicht aufgelistet wird, muss er noch in /etc/X11/xorg.conf (Section "Screen" in Zeile Mode) entsprechend nachgetragen werden.

Tastenbelegung (Meta-Key/Super-Key)

Unter Ubuntu Windows-L zum Sperren des Bildschirms verwenden:

Dazu die Alternative (System - Einstellungen - Tastenkombinationen - Bildschirm - Sperren deaktivieren)!

  • compconfig installieren:
sudo aptitude install compizconfig-settings-manager
  • CompizConfig Einstellungsmanager starten:
tim@acantha:~$ ccsm
  • General Options - Commands - Commands
gnome-screensaver-command --lock
  • General Options - Commands - Key Bindings
Run Command 1 - <Super>l 
  • installierte Pakete:
tim@acantha:~$ dpkg -l | grep compiz
ii  compiz                                     1:0.7.8-0ubuntu4.1                                   OpenGL window and compositing manager
ii  compiz-core                                1:0.7.8-0ubuntu4.1                                   OpenGL window and compositing manager
ii  compiz-fusion-plugins-extra                0.7.8-0ubuntu2                                       Collection of extra plugins from OpenComposi
ii  compiz-fusion-plugins-main                 0.7.8-0ubuntu2                                       Collection of plugins from OpenCompositing f
ii  compiz-gnome                               1:0.7.8-0ubuntu4.1                                   OpenGL window and compositing manager - GNOM
ii  compiz-plugins                             1:0.7.8-0ubuntu4.1                                   OpenGL window and compositing manager - plug
ii  compiz-wrapper                             1:0.7.8-0ubuntu4.1                                   OpenGL window and compositing manager, wrapp
ii  compizconfig-backend-gconf                 0.7.8-0ubuntu1                                       Settings library for plugins - OpenCompositi
ii  compizconfig-settings-manager              0.7.8-0ubuntu3                                       Compiz configuration settings manager
ii  libcompizconfig0                           0.7.8-0ubuntu2                                       Settings library for plugins - OpenCompositi
ii  python-compizconfig                        0.7.8-0ubuntu1                                       Compiz configuration system bindings
tim@acantha:~$ 

Cronjobs troubleshooting

  • Testen der cron-configuration:
run-parts -v --test /etc/cron.daily/
  • NB: Die Namen der cron-Skripte dürfen keine Punkte enthalten, sonst werden sie nicht ausgeführt.

Ubuntu create .deb-Package Howto

Unix/Linux allgemein

  • terminal session aufzeichnen mit script:
script -t 2>timing.out -a session.script